Interesting facts
1

The park hosts the world's first captive-born white tiger population, originating from normal-colored parents in 1980.

2

The resident Kanjia Lake is a designated Wetland of National Importance under the National Wetland Conservation Programme.

3

It maintains an extensive botanical garden covering over 75 hectares within its boundaries.

4

The zoo serves as a major rescue and rehabilitation center for injured wildlife found within Odisha's forest regions.

5

Nandankanan is one of the few zoos in India to possess an aquarium with a dedicated freshwater exhibit.

Overview

Nandankanan Zoological Park is recognized for being the first zoo in the world to breed the endangered white tiger in captivity. Situated along the periphery of the Chandaka-Dampara Wildlife Sanctuary, the facility spans over 400 hectares of forest land. It houses the Kanjia Lake, a major wetland ecosystem that supports a diverse range of migratory bird species. The zoo is a nodal center for the conservation of the Gharial crocodile, featuring a specialized captive breeding program. The safari section allows visitors to traverse naturalistic enclosures designed for large carnivores, including tigers and lions. The site functions as a botanical garden and a biological park, integrating ex-situ and in-situ conservation efforts. It currently operates under the administrative control of the Forest Department of the Government of Odisha.
